KongZhong Corporation Announces Board and Management Changes
Monday, July 20, 2009 8:01 AM


BEIJING, July 20 /PRNewswire-Asia/ -- KongZhong Corporation (Nasdaq: KONG), a leading mobile Internet company in China, today announced that the Company's Board of Directors has elected Mr. Charles Xue to the Board, effective July 20, 2009. Mr. Xue will serve as an Independent Director and on the Audit, Compensation and Nomination Committees of the Board. Mr. Xue replaces Mr. Xiaolong Li, who resigned from the Board on July 20, 2009 for personal reasons. Mr. Xue will serve the remainder of Mr. Li's term, which ends in 2011.

Mr. Xue was the original founder of UT Starcom, a global leader and a Nasdaq listed company in the manufacture, integration and support of Internet protocol-based, end-to-end networking and telecommunications solutions, and served as its chairman and vice chairman from 1991 to 2001. Previously, Mr. Xue was the original founder and director of ChinaEdu Corporation, a leading educational service provider in China and Nasdaq listed company.

Commenting on Mr. Xue's appointment, the Company's Chairman and Chief Executive Officer, Leilei Wang, said, 'Charles' appointment is a wonderful addition to our Board. We believe that his acute business insight will be of great value to the Company. We look forward to working closely with him.'

In addition, Mr. Nick Yang, one of the co-founders of the Company, has informed the Board of his decision to resign from his President and Chief Technology Officer positions at the Company, effective July 31, 2009. Mr. Yang will continue to serve as a non-executive Director and the Vice Chairman of the Board.

Regarding Mr. Yang's resignation, Leilei Wang, said, 'I truly appreciate all the contributions Nick has made to the Company since its founding and look forward to his continued support and partnership at the board level as Vice Chairman.'

About KongZhong

KongZhong Corporation is a leading mobile Internet company in China. The Company delivers wireless value-added services to consumers in China through multiple technology platforms including wireless application protocol (WAP), multimedia messaging service (MMS), Java , short messaging service (SMS), interactive voice response (IVR), and color ring-back tone (CRBT). The Company operates three wireless Internet sites, Kong.net, Ko.cn and cn.NBA.com, which enable users to access media, entertainment and community content directly from their mobile phones.
